My ATI HD4980 has video memory broken so I need to replace it.

Since I want to use linux (linux mint) and I heard NVIDA was so much better for the driver I was wondering if that was true.

Also Spring is kinda the only game I am using so I would like to have your feedback about NVIDA GPU you used with spring/linux

Since My system is a bit old now (i5 750 4Go RAM), I dont think I need something really good anyway.

I am mostly interested by the stability of the card and its behavior with compiz that sometimes was hanging 100% on ubuntu 12.04 x64

At last I like to program with CUDA so I would prefer most recent cards (and if possible double precision by using some manual tweaking but I guess I am dreaming here :D)

If you have any advises, I take them !

Thanks !

Edit: I was thinking to go for a Geforce 500 serie. Question is: do you think that is actually too much cause of my old i5 750 ?

The 560ti represented the best value for money in the last gen of geforce cards and can handle pretty much everything that can be thrown at it. The new 6xx cards are still expensive and unless you're powering 3 or 4 monitors you wont see the difference in performance ( maxed out )

(i5 750 4Go RAM),
That is an absolutely excellent CPU. If you think its aging a bit, just bump the BLCK to 150 or 166 mhz, and it will magically get better, for free, on stock voltage, stock cooler.

I have a 560ti, its awesome. Quiet and plays everything maxed (I also have the same i5 750 :)

is stock 560ti really better than a 460GT OC? (most are ~15% overclocked)

series 6xx has nice new features - bindless textures, better double precision, 2nd DMA controller, ... - still it's ways too expensive for those.

edit:
Nvm since 460 isn't produced anymore their price just got much higher, nor are there any superclocked ones available.
